APC Thugs Arrested for Alleged Gun Smuggling in Edo State Ahead of Governorship Election

By Wisdom Tide
21/09/2024


Security operatives in Edo State have arrested several individuals alleged to be thugs sponsored by the All Progressives Congress (APC). These individuals were reportedly caught attempting to smuggle guns and other weapons into the state ahead of the upcoming off-cycle governorship election scheduled for September 21st, 2024.

Arrest of Suspected APC Thugs

A video shared by the Peoples Democratic Party (PDP) on its official X (formerly Twitter) handle late Friday night captured the arrest of the suspects. The video shows security officers stopping a Sienna vehicle and recovering firearms and other illegal materials. The voices in the background of the video accuse the apprehended individuals of being sent by the APC to disrupt the election.

The accompanying post from the PDP reads:
“Security Operatives and the people of Edo State apprehend @OfficialAPCNg thugs trying to smuggle guns into Edo State ahead of Saturday’s governorship election. We salute the courage of the Edo people in their determination to ensure that only the will of the people prevails.”

APC Yet to Respond

At the time of filing this report, the APC had not yet issued any statement or responded to the allegations and the video. The political atmosphere in Edo State remains tense as voters prepare to choose their next governor. The three leading candidates in the election are Asue Ighodalo of the PDP, Monday Okpebholo of the APC, and Olumide Akpata of the Labour Party (LP).
